Eclipse Magazine - The Social Side of Racing
eclipsemagazine.co.uk is a uniquely positioned, independent, daily updated online magazine for both men and women, focusing on the ‘lifestyle’ elements of horseracing. eclipse aims to present the racegoer with a fun and social perspective on the racing world alongside elements of the core sport, and includes interviews with owners, trainers and jockeys, plus features on fashion, food & drink and racecourse events. featuring accessible and attractive information, eclipse also plays an important role in the development of the racing industry, by helping to bridge the gap between those already ‘in the know’ – racing enthusiasts, and those attending a meeting for the first time.
